Album Review
EPMD's reunion album "Back in Business" may not be entirely successful, but it's far from being an embarrassment. Erick Sermon and Parrish Smith remain strong, if unexceptional rappers, but the true news is in the music. Much of "Back in Business" captures the wild spirit of EPMD's classic late-'80s albums, complete with dense layers of sounds, samples and funky beats. There's enough skill and invention in the production -- and just enough energy in the rapping -- to make "Back in Business" a welcome comeback. ~ Leo Stanley, All Music Guide
